8-K: CAVA Group Announces Board Changes and Approves Equity Incentive Plan Amendment at Annual Meeting
Corporate Governance Update
CAVA Group's annual meeting saw the election of three directors, approval of an equity incentive plan amendment, and the appointment of a new Audit Committee Chair.
Summary
- CAVA Group held its annual meeting on June 20, 2024, where several key decisions were made.
- Todd Klein did not stand for re-election, ending his term on the Board of Directors.
- James D. White was appointed to the Audit Committee, and David Bosserman was appointed as the new Chair of the Audit Committee, succeeding Todd Klein.
- The size of the Board was reduced from ten to nine members.
- Three Class I directors, Philippe Amouyal, David Bosserman, and Lauri Shanahan, were elected to the Board.
- An amendment and restatement of the 2023 Equity Incentive Plan was approved.
- The selection of Deloitte & Touche LLP as the independent registered public accounting firm for the year ending December 29, 2024, was ratified.

Management Comments
- Mr. Klein's decision not to stand for re-election was not the result of any disagreement between the Company and him on any matter relating to the Company's operations, policies or practices.
